What does Verbum Domini mean in English?
The Word of the Lord
Verbum Domini (The Word of the Lord) is a post-synodal apostolic exhortation issued by Pope Benedict XVI which deals with how the Catholic church should approach the Bible.

What to say after reading the Gospel?
As we stand for the reading of the gospel, we join in singing Alleluia. The Alleluia is a song of praise to God. During Lent, instead of the Alleluia, we say other words of praise, such as: Praise to you, Lord Jesus Christ, King of endless glory. We respond: Glory to you, Lord.
What is the third mark of the church?
The Marks of the Church are those things by which the True Church may be recognized in Protestant theology. Three marks are usually enumerated: the preaching of the Word, the administration of the sacraments, and church discipline.

What is liturgy and why should we want to participate?
Liturgy is public worship – the work of Christ and that of the Church, the Body of Christ. By virtue of our participation in Christ’s work as members of the Body, we also participate in the divine life of the Trinity, an eternal exchange of love between the Father, Son, and Holy Spirit.
What are the four constitutions?
Four constitutions:
- Sacrosanctum Concilium (Sacred Liturgy)
- Lumen gentium (The Church)
- Dei verbum (Divine Revelation)
- Gaudium et spes (The Modern World)

Is catholic Church a true church?
According to the Catechism of the Catholic Church, Catholic ecclesiology professes the Catholic Church to be the “sole Church of Christ” – i.e., the one true church defined as “one, holy, catholic, and apostolic” in the Four Marks of the Church in the Nicene Creed.

What is the meaning of ultimum hominis finem patefacit Verbum?
Ultimum hominis finem patefacit verbum Dei universalemque addit sensum ipsius actionibus in terris. The word of God reveals the final destiny of men and women and provides a unifying explanation of all that they do in the world.
